Output c8581303f6e3c0d46230c0fd4389857a3d8263a42126ed4413f4886f0d2502ea:1

value
27332417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3689965f9183ea0b4bb74abff954a3f52dfae6d OP_EQUAL
address
MUdavf2HPZ6wkoGYCFbXYE5dCgTd2T5Uh4
transaction
c8581303f6e3c0d46230c0fd4389857a3d8263a42126ed4413f4886f0d2502ea
spent
true